What This Means for Hiring
SvelteKit developers often chose it deliberately—they prefer its approach over React. They value performance, simplicity, and elegant solutions. The smaller ecosystem means more self-reliance.

Recruiter's Cheat Sheet: Spotting Great Candidates
Conversation Starters That Reveal Skill Level
| Question | Junior Answer | Senior Answer |
|---|---|---|
| "Why Svelte vs React?" | "Svelte is simpler" | "Compile-time vs runtime. Svelte compiles to minimal JS without virtual DOM overhead. React's abstraction has cost. Choice depends on performance needs and team preference." |
| "How does reactivity work in Svelte?" | "It's automatic" | "Compiler detects assignments to reactive variables and generates update code. $: creates reactive statements. No manual dependency arrays like React hooks." |
| "Explain load functions in SvelteKit." | "They load data" | "Run on server (or universally) before page renders. Return data to page components. Handle SSR and client navigation differently. +page.server.js vs +page.js distinction." |

Common Hiring Mistakes
1. Treating Svelte Experience as Rare
Svelte has grown significantly. Many React developers have learned it. Don't assume candidates are impossible to find—the pool has grown.
2. Requiring Years of SvelteKit
SvelteKit hit 1.0 in late 2022. Requiring years of experience is unrealistic. Value Svelte understanding and web development fundamentals.
3. Testing React Patterns
Svelte's reactivity model differs from React hooks. Testing useState/useEffect patterns misses Svelte's approach. Test Svelte-specific patterns.
4. Ignoring Transferable Skills
Strong React or Vue developers can learn Svelte quickly. The compilation model is different, but web fundamentals transfer. Value learning ability alongside specific experience.
